logo

Output 74dd228ad9526d9599f9c53df421ed62a8a77d4f1c0fde295ff29a1a33eadaa6:0

value
33375824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c627149fdf48dfd977699aec20087d302908e21d OP_EQUAL
address
3KkkXtevGpkvCGYN9gNMw9o7AXVyaBBf2u
transaction
74dd228ad9526d9599f9c53df421ed62a8a77d4f1c0fde295ff29a1a33eadaa6